 | class NamespaceSeparatorTest(unittest.TestCase): | 
 |     def test_legal(self): | 
 |         # Tests that make sure we get errors when the namespace_separator value | 
 |         # is illegal, and that we don't for good values: | 
 |         expat.ParserCreate() | 
 |         expat.ParserCreate(namespace_separator=None) | 
 |         expat.ParserCreate(namespace_separator=' ') | 
 |  | 
 |     def test_illegal(self): | 
 |         try: | 
 |             expat.ParserCreate(namespace_separator=42) | 
 |             self.fail() | 
 |         except TypeError as e: | 
 |             self.assertEquals(str(e), | 
 |                 'ParserCreate() argument 2 must be string or None, not int') | 
 |  | 
 |         try: | 
 |             expat.ParserCreate(namespace_separator='too long') | 
 |             self.fail() | 
 |         except ValueError as e: | 
 |             self.assertEquals(str(e), | 
 |                 'namespace_separator must be at most one character, omitted, or None') | 
 |  | 
 |     def test_zero_length(self): | 
 |         # ParserCreate() needs to accept a namespace_separator of zero length | 
 |         # to satisfy the requirements of RDF applications that are required | 
 |         # to simply glue together the namespace URI and the localname.  Though | 
 |         # considered a wart of the RDF specifications, it needs to be supported. | 
 |         # | 
 |         # See XML-SIG mailing list thread starting with | 
 |         # http://mail.python.org/pipermail/xml-sig/2001-April/005202.html | 
 |         # | 
 |         expat.ParserCreate(namespace_separator='') # too short | 
 |  |

 | class BufferTextTest(unittest.TestCase): | 
 |     def setUp(self): | 
 |         self.stuff = [] | 
 |         self.parser = expat.ParserCreate() | 
 |         self.parser.buffer_text = 1 | 
 |         self.parser.CharacterDataHandler = self.CharacterDataHandler | 
 |  | 
 |     def check(self, expected, label): | 
 |         self.assertEquals(self.stuff, expected, | 
 |                 "%s\nstuff    = %r\nexpected = %r" | 
 |                 % (label, self.stuff, map(str, expected))) | 
 |  | 
 |     def CharacterDataHandler(self, text): | 
 |         self.stuff.append(text) | 
 |  | 
 |     def StartElementHandler(self, name, attrs): | 
 |         self.stuff.append("<%s>" % name) | 
 |         bt = attrs.get("buffer-text") | 
 |         if bt == "yes": | 
 |             self.parser.buffer_text = 1 | 
 |         elif bt == "no": | 
 |             self.parser.buffer_text = 0 | 
 |  | 
 |     def EndElementHandler(self, name): | 
 |         self.stuff.append("</%s>" % name) | 
 |  | 
 |     def CommentHandler(self, data): | 
 |         self.stuff.append("<!--%s-->" % data) | 
 |  | 
 |     def setHandlers(self, handlers=[]): | 
 |         for name in handlers: | 
 |             setattr(self.parser, name, getattr(self, name)) | 
 |  | 
 |     def test_default_to_disabled(self): | 
 |         parser = expat.ParserCreate() | 
 |         self.assertFalse(parser.buffer_text) | 
 |  | 
 |     def test_buffering_enabled(self): | 
 |         # Make sure buffering is turned on | 
 |         self.assertTrue(self.parser.buffer_text) | 
 |         self.parser.Parse("<a>1<b/>2<c/>3</a>", 1) | 
 |         self.assertEquals(self.stuff, ['123'], | 
 |                           "buffered text not properly collapsed") | 
 |  | 
 |     def test1(self): | 
 |         # XXX This test exposes more detail of Expat's text chunking than we | 
 |         # XXX like, but it tests what we need to concisely. | 
 |         self.setHandlers(["StartElementHandler"]) | 
 |         self.parser.Parse("<a>1<b buffer-text='no'/>2\n3<c buffer-text='yes'/>4\n5</a>", 1) | 
 |         self.assertEquals(self.stuff, | 
 |                           ["<a>", "1", "<b>", "2", "\n", "3", "<c>", "4\n5"], | 
 |                           "buffering control not reacting as expected") | 
 |  | 
 |     def test2(self): | 
 |         self.parser.Parse("<a>1<b/><2><c/> \n 3</a>", 1) | 
 |         self.assertEquals(self.stuff, ["1<2> \n 3"], | 
 |                           "buffered text not properly collapsed") | 
 |  | 
 |     def test3(self): | 
 |         self.setHandlers(["StartElementHandler"]) | 
 |         self.parser.Parse("<a>1<b/>2<c/>3</a>", 1) | 
 |         self.assertEquals(self.stuff, ["<a>", "1", "<b>", "2", "<c>", "3"], | 
 |                           "buffered text not properly split") | 
 |  | 
 |     def test4(self): | 
 |         self.setHandlers(["StartElementHandler", "EndElementHandler"]) | 
 |         self.parser.CharacterDataHandler = None | 
 |         self.parser.Parse("<a>1<b/>2<c/>3</a>", 1) | 
 |         self.assertEquals(self.stuff, | 
 |                           ["<a>", "<b>", "</b>", "<c>", "</c>", "</a>"]) | 
 |  | 
 |     def test5(self): | 
 |         self.setHandlers(["StartElementHandler", "EndElementHandler"]) | 
 |         self.parser.Parse("<a>1<b></b>2<c/>3</a>", 1) | 
 |         self.assertEquals(self.stuff, | 
 |             ["<a>", "1", "<b>", "</b>", "2", "<c>", "</c>", "3", "</a>"]) | 
 |  | 
 |     def test6(self): | 
 |         self.setHandlers(["CommentHandler", "EndElementHandler", | 
 |                     "StartElementHandler"]) | 
 |         self.parser.Parse("<a>1<b/>2<c></c>345</a> ", 1) | 
 |         self.assertEquals(self.stuff, | 
 |             ["<a>", "1", "<b>", "</b>", "2", "<c>", "</c>", "345", "</a>"], | 
 |             "buffered text not properly split") | 
 |  | 
 |     def test7(self): | 
 |         self.setHandlers(["CommentHandler", "EndElementHandler", | 
 |                     "StartElementHandler"]) | 
 |         self.parser.Parse("<a>1<b/>2<c></c>3<!--abc-->4<!--def-->5</a> ", 1) | 
 |         self.assertEquals(self.stuff, | 
 |                           ["<a>", "1", "<b>", "</b>", "2", "<c>", "</c>", "3", | 
 |                            "<!--abc-->", "4", "<!--def-->", "5", "</a>"], | 
 |                           "buffered text not properly split") |
